Product Summary

The SWD-119 is a quad channel driver used to translate TTL control inputs into gate control voltages for GaAs FET microwave switches and attenuators. High speed analog CMOS technology of SWD-119 is utilized to achieve low power dissipation at moderate to high speeds, encompassing most microwave switching applications. The output HIGH level of SWD-119 is optionally 0 to +2.0V (relative to GND) to optimize the intermodulation products of the control devices at low frequencies.

Parametrics

SWD-119 absolute maximum ratings: (1)Positive DC Supply Voltage: 4.5 V min, 5.0 V typ and 5.5 V max; (2)Negative DC Supply Voltage: -8.5 V min, -5.0 V typ and -4.5 V max; (3)Optional DC Output Supply Voltage: 0 V min, 1.0 V typ and 2.0 V max; (4)Negative Supply Voltage Range: 4.5 V min, 6.5 V typ, 8.5 V max; (5)Positive to negative Supply Range: 9.0 V min, 10.0 V typ and 14.0 V max; (6)Operating Ambient temperature: -40 to +85 ℃; (7)DC Output Current - High: -1.0 mA; (8)DC Output Current - Low: 1.0 mA; (9)Maximum Input Rise or Fall Time: 500 nS.

Features

SWD-119 features: (1)High Speed CMOS Technology; (2)Quad Channel; (3)Positive Voltage Control; (4)Low Power Dissipation; (5)Low Cost Plastic SOIC-16 Package.
